You’ve learned a lot about how to stop a nosebleed quickly. Remember:
– Nosebleeds can happen to anyone, but they’re usually caused by dry air, blowing your nose too hard, or injury to the nose.
– Basic first aid for nosebleeds involves tilting your head forward and pinching your nostrils together.
– Applying ice packs or something cold against your forehead can sometimes help.
